Looking for complex organizations in Finland

The recommendation technology which I'm working on at Cluetail will be most beneficial to organizations with complex communications structures.

As a starting point for mapping complex organizations in Finland, I am hoping to find a list of large, internationally operating, Finnish companies (and other organizations), sorted by number of employees.

Any advice on where to look?